1. A personal video library system, comprising:
- a) a personal video depot (PVD) wherein said PVD comprisesi) a nonvolatile storage;
ii) a TV interface function;
iii) a content capture function;
iv) a rights verification and assignment; and
v) an identification (ID) authentication of a user;
b) said content capture function provides capability to ingest video content comprising;
i) an analog video from an analog video camera;
ii) a digital video from a digital video camera;
iii) a physical DVD purchased by the user; and
iv) a video purchased from a server;
c) wherein said user of the PVD registered with said server selects a title of a video from a menu of the server to be purchased, downloaded and stored in said nonvolatile storage of the PVD, whereby communications between the server and the PVD through a network interface port of the capture content function;
d) whereupon authentication of the user ID, the rights verification and assignment performed on the video content stored in the nonvolatile storage with the video;
e) after which the user selects said video content to be displayed on a TV screen, connected to the TV interface, from amongst a listing of previously stored video content within said nonvolatile storage; and
f) subsequent viewing of each video stored in said PVD with the rights verification and assignment requires said ID authentication of the user.

Abstract
A video library is formed within a personal video depot (PVD). The PVD has capability to accept purchased video'"'"'s and DVD'"'"'s as well as personal video'"'"'s captured on camcorders. The purchased video'"'"'s and DVD'"'"'s are rights verified and assigned to a user having an authenticated ID. The PVD has capability to play a selected video on a TV as well as acquire additional video titles from the server connected to the depot through a network. A menu is displayed on a TV from which a remote control is used to make selections that affect the purchase of video titles and operation of the PVD.

8. A method for acquiring a video title from a server, comprising:
-
a) authenticating a user of a personal video depot (PVD); b) contacting a server with which said user is registered; c) selecting a desired video from a list of video titles; d) verifying the user and an account of the user; e) purchasing and downloading the desired video to the PVD; f) performing a rights verification and assignment on the desired video; and g) storing the desired video and the rights verification and assignment in a non-volatile storage of the PVD. - View Dependent Claims (9, 10, 11, 12, 13)
